Back End Engineer Job at Robert Half, 東京都

MlZreEJQbVlVV3NBdVVuWmV3Mm9ueFVaeGc9PQ==
  • Robert Half
  • 東京都

Job Description

Build Japan's Payment Future with ML & Functional Programming

Company Profile
A rapidly growing fintech company transforming digital commerce in Japan is seeking a Product Engineer. The platform processes millions of transactions using proprietary machine learning models to enable seamless online shopping experiences. Backed by major global payment companies and leading financial institutions, the organization combines innovative technology with enterprise stability. The engineering team represents 40+ nationalities working in English, maintaining a casual, collaborative culture at their central Tokyo office.

The Role
  • Architect and scale payment platform components while maintaining security, resilience, and maintainability standards for high-volume transaction processing
  • Collaborate directly with product teams to translate business objectives into technical solutions, communicating design tradeoffs clearly across engineering and product stakeholders
  • Work cross-functionally in feature teams to deliver services that directly impact user acquisition and conversion rates
  • Participate in systematic code reviews and maintain testing practices that ensure production-grade quality for mission-critical payment infrastructure
  • Stay current with industry patterns and suggest performance improvements based on data-driven insights from real-world payment flows
  • Navigate ambiguity with sound judgment while defining deliverables and maintaining urgency for business-critical releases


Your Skills
Essential Requirements:

  • Proficiency in Scala (or strong in functional programming like Rust, Haskell, C++) with curiosity about functional programming paradigms
  • Strong grasp of software architecture, design patterns, and how they align with distributed service structures
  • Experience writing clean, maintainable code with systematic debugging approaches and automated testing mindset
  • Understanding of security implications across distributed systems and payment infrastructure
  • Comfortable reading unfamiliar codebases and making intelligent inferences about broader system context
  • Genuine interest in how engineering strategy connects to product development and business growth

Bonus Experience (Not Required but Valued):

  • Hands-on experience with Scala, Cassandra, Kafka, PostgreSQL, AWS (Fargate/Terraform), or functional programming libraries (cats, cats-effect)
  • Background in microservices architecture, event sourcing, CQRS patterns, or REST API design
  • Previous work on payment platforms, distributed systems, or fintech products
  • Understanding of cross-team dependencies and ability to envision technical roadmaps


Key Highlights of the Role

  • Solve genuine technical challenges at scale. Building payment infrastructure that underwrites real-time transactions using proprietary ML models for major e-commerce platforms
  • Work with a modern functional programming stack (Scala, cats-effect, tagless final) alongside distributed systems technologies like Kafka, Cassandra, and event sourcing architectures
  • Join a truly international engineering team where English is the working language and colleagues represent 40+ nationalities - rare opportunity for Tokyo tech roles
  • Shape technology evolution in a well-funded organization transitioning from startup agility to enterprise scale
  • Enjoy genuine work-life balance with full flextime (no core hours), up to 3 days remote per week and generous paid time off (20+ days from first year)
  • Competitive compensation package with comprehensive retirement programs and premium central Tokyo office access

Job Tags

Similar Jobs

BD

Associate Director, Program / Project Manager Job at BD

 ...business and/or technical problems at all levels of the organization. A strong, influential...  ...degree in an engineering discipline or MBA Six-sigma design and development background...  ...of associates progress, ranging from entry level to experts in their field, and talent... 

Marriott International

Barista Job at Marriott International

 ...by Supervisors. PREFERRED QUALIFICATIONS Education: High school diploma or G.E.D. equivalent. Related Work Experience: No related work experience. Supervisory Experience: No supervisory experience. License or Certification: None... 

Compass Group

BARISTA (FULL TIME AND PART TIME) Job at Compass Group

 ...We are hiring immediately for full time and part time BARISTA positions. Location : Chadron State College - 1000 Main Street...  ...included. More details upon interview. Requirement : No previous experience required. Perks: Free shift meals! Pay Range: $15.00per... 

ピコ・インターナショナル株式会社

Junior Accountant / ジュニア経理担当 Flex-time・Multicultural team Job at ピコ・インターナショナル株式会社

 ...nt or Finance Manager roles, offering clear career growth prospects Flexible working environment supported by full flex-time and remote work systems Job ResponsibilitiesPico Group is a Hong Konglisted global organization with offi... 

Norwegian Cruise Line Holdings

Island Lifeguard Bahamas Job at Norwegian Cruise Line Holdings

TheIsland Lifeguardis reponsible for monitoring and operating designated aquatic recreation spaces including, opening and closing while monitoring safety around the beach areas. Set up and verify that supplies and equipment are available during operating hours, replenish...